Foros del Web » Programación para mayores de 30 ;) » C/C++ »

Ayuda con librerias

Estas en el tema de Ayuda con librerias en el foro de C/C++ en Foros del Web. Hola a todos!! Estoy un poco desesperado, la historia, mas o menos resumida es que para terminar la carrera tengo que aprobar una asignatura optativa, ...
  #1 (permalink)  
Antiguo 21/04/2010, 19:14
 
Fecha de Ingreso: abril-2010
Mensajes: 6
Antigüedad: 14 años
Puntos: 0
Ayuda con librerias

Hola a todos!! Estoy un poco desesperado, la historia, mas o menos resumida es que para terminar la carrera tengo que aprobar una asignatura optativa, la cual, inteligente de mi, y dado que las asignaturas de programacion de los 4 cursos anteriores me gustaron pues decidi elegir programacion en c++. El caso es que ahora para aprobar, a mi me ha tocado desarrollar un programa con codigos Bidimensionales, as que me he puesto manos a la obra, pero no me ha dado tiempo a empezar, porque concretamente estoy intentando utilizar el [URL="http://code.google.com/p/zxing/"]Zxing[/URL] de Google Code para C++ y a ver que puedo sacar.

El problema es que tengo que instalar las librerias y es algo que nunca he hecho y que mi profesor basicamente me llamo imbecil porque se me ocurrio preguntarle como se hacia. De hecho llevo 3 dias con el tiempo completamente perdido porque no se como cojones instalar las librerias en el Windows XP. Buscando y buscando encontre que lo hiciera con Visual Studio, pero el unico programa que encuentro es de Windows, y pesa mas de 2 GB asi que dudo que sea esa, aunque incluso lo descargue y lo comprobe.

Bueno, me gustaria saber si alguien puede ayudarme porque estoy al borde de la locura. Incluso he intentado a la desesperada copiar todas las librerias en la carpeta include para ver si asi funcionaba, pero, sorprendentemente nada...
  #2 (permalink)  
Antiguo 21/04/2010, 21:44
Avatar de razpeitia
Moderador
 
Fecha de Ingreso: marzo-2005
Ubicación: Monterrey, México
Mensajes: 7.321
Antigüedad: 19 años, 1 mes
Puntos: 1360
Respuesta: Ayuda con librerias

Relájate, yo también soy estudiante de universidad y la verdad es que algunos profesores se crecen cuando les preguntas algo. Pero bueno eso es otro tema.

Supongo que estas utilizando windows + visual studio.

La verdad es que en windows instalar librerías es mas complicado que tratar de besar a la novia enfrente de los suegros.

Por que varia con cada libreria, con cada compilador, etc..
Eso sin mencionar que tienes que crear tu propio makefile (en visual studio creo que son proyectos) con los parámetros para poder compilar la librería.

Este proyecto esta originalmente para java, fue portado parcialmente a c++.

Cita:
Iniciado por README
This is only tested on Linux. With some trouble, it might work on Windows as well.

To build the library only:
- Install scons
- Run "scons lib" in this folder (cpp).

To build the unit tests:
- Install cppunit (libcppunit-dev on Ubuntu)
- Run "scons tests"
- Run "testrunner" in the build folder

To build the test utility:
- Install Magick++ (libmagick++-dev on Ubuntu)
- Run "scons zxing"

An simple example application is now also included, but no compilation instructions yet.

To clean:
- Run "scons -c all"

To use the test utility:
- Basic usage:
- "mkdir testout"
- "zxing testout *.jpg > report.html"
- With the zxing test data, from the cpp folder:
- "mkdir testout"
- "build/zxing testout ../core/test/data/blackbox/qrcode-*/* > report.html"

To format the code:
- Install astyle
- Run ./format

To profile the code (very useful to optimize the code):
- Install valgrind
- "valgrind --tool=callgrind build/zxing - path/to/test/data/*.jpg > report.html"
- kcachegrind is a very nice tool to analize the output
  #3 (permalink)  
Antiguo 22/04/2010, 11:29
 
Fecha de Ingreso: abril-2010
Mensajes: 6
Antigüedad: 14 años
Puntos: 0
Respuesta: Ayuda con librerias

Muchas gracias por responder tan rapido. Hoy habia pensao en tomarme el dia libre con respecto a esto, pero mi conciencia (y el tiempo, principalmente) no me lo permite y esta noche despues de cenar volvere a ver si consigo hacer algo. Lo cierto es que casi todo lo que me has dicho me suena a chino, porque usar, uso el Dev c++ y, de vez en cuando el Borland Builder 6. Ahora mismo estoy maldiciendo a mis amigos que se han cogido empresas y lo unico que hacen es copiarse, aunque asi visto por encima creo que no tengo ni idea de que tengo que hacer, esta noche cuando lo vaya viendo comentare.
  #4 (permalink)  
Antiguo 08/05/2010, 11:00
 
Fecha de Ingreso: abril-2010
Mensajes: 6
Antigüedad: 14 años
Puntos: 0
Respuesta: Ayuda con librerias

Al final el dia libre de hacer este programa se ha convertido en 15 dias, a ver si ahora sin tener la mente estresada consigo instalar las putas librerias

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:30.